Deciphering Ethereum’s Recent Trends: Profit-Taking vs. Accumulation

Is Ethereum Facing a Correction? Analyzing Current Market Trends

Ethereum (ETH) has recently encountered significant turbulence in its price movement, particularly after a notable surge that saw it reach $2,700 approximately a week ago. However, it’s worth noting that since hitting this mark, the altcoin has struggled to maintain its momentum and has subsequently experienced a downward correction, dipping to a low of around $2,300. For the past three days, ETH has remained trapped within the $2,500 to $2,300 range, leaving traders and investors pondering its future trajectory amid conflicting signals from the market.

Evaluating Market Behavior and Technical Indicators

A recent analysis by CryptoQuant’s expert, Shayan, suggests that Ethereum is currently overheating around the $2,500 resistance level. This overheating is highlighted by a significant increase in trading volume, primarily fueled by profit-taking activities from traders who capitalized on the recent price surge. This surge in trading volume typically works as a precursor to a market correction, painting a complex picture of ETH’s current standing. The current plateau may well signify a cooling-off phase, which could pave the way for fresh accumulation as the market prepares itself for renewed bullish sentiment.

Exchange Netflow: A Sign of Accumulation

One intriguing sign amid the volatility is the sustained negative netflow of Ethereum on exchanges. Over the last four consecutive days, withdrawals from exchanges have notably outpaced inflows. This pattern is emblematic of accumulation, as long-term holders appear to be withdrawing their assets from exchanges and holding them in anticipation of future price increases. This behavior suggests that, despite the short-term price retraction, there is a strong underlying belief among investors that ETH is fundamentally undervalued, which may mitigate the risks of a prolonged correction.

MVRV Z Score: Indicators of Undervaluation

While short-term market dynamics might suggest that Ethereum is due for a correction, an analysis from AMBCrypto indicates otherwise. The altcoin’s Market Value to Realized Value (MVRV) Z score has primarily remained in negative territory over the past week. Historically, periods where this score dips into negative territory have coincided with macro market bottoms, portraying an opportunity for informed investors to capitalize on undervalued assets. Instances of negative MVRV Z scores were recorded in significant market corrections during previous years, emphasizing historical repetition and the potential for a rebound.

Long-Term vs. Short-Term Holders: MVRV Dynamics

The analysis doesn’t end with the MVRV alone; it extends to comparing long-term and short-term holder metrics. Currently, the MVRV difference between these two categories indicates that short-term holders are yielding better returns than long-term holders, pointing to a shifting market sentiment where short-term speculation is driving price movements. Since long-term holders are generally reluctant to sell during periods of loss, this reluctance implies stability in the market, particularly when significant offloading from these holders is unlikely.

Future Prospects: What Lies Ahead for Ethereum?

Even though the recent surge in trading volume has raised eyebrows, Ethereum remains far from an overheated state. In fact, the underlying fundamentals suggest that the altcoin is significantly undervalued, providing opportunities for new accumulation. As only short-term holders are currently selling, accumulating addresses are effectively absorbing the resultant selling pressure. This interaction implies that Ethereum is expected to enter a consolidation phase while awaiting enhanced demand to trigger a breakout above key resistance levels. In the mid-term, should bullish sentiments materialize, Ethereum could initiate a rally towards $1,800.

In conclusion, while Ethereum grapples with short-term price fluctuations and signs of potential market corrections, the underlying indicators suggest a healthy ecosystem is forming. Long-term holders’ reluctance to sell, coupled with strong accumulation trends, provides a robust foundation for future growth, making Ethereum a noteworthy asset in any investment portfolio. As the market continues to evolve, keen observers will watch for the emergence of renewed demand that could propel Ethereum past its current resistance levels.
